Legacy

Former actress active in the 1970s, known for the role of Yuriko Misaki / Electro Human Tackle in Kamen Rider Stronger with a loyal fan base. Died young due to internal organ disease caused by asthma.

Trivia

  • Stage name was given by Sho Okada, president of Toei.
  • In junior high, she belonged to the track and field club and was a sprinter.
  • She wore the mask and suit herself during action scenes.
  • After retirement, she ran an izakaya in Chofu.
